Beautiful Eddy Merckx Millenium 3 titanium frame, very nicely appointed with Ultegra 9 speed and other choice components from that era. The frame is Litespeed titanium and one of their rare offerings: a mix of 6/4 and 3/2.5, with Merckx dropouts. This mix of titanium was also offered on the Litespeed Ultimate, their highest end model of the time.
